研究了镁铝水滑石的制备和微波改性工艺,通过正交实验考察了改性温度、改性时间、钛酸酯用量等因素对活化指数的影响,钛酸酯改性镁铝水滑石的最佳条件为:钛酸酯用量为5%,改性温度为75℃,改性时间为30 min.并对改性前后的镁铝水滑石添加至PVC中进行了性能测试.实验结果表明:镁铝水滑石能改善PVC的热稳定性,加工性能,阻燃消烟作用明显,改性后的镁铝水滑石性能更优.
Preparation and Modification of Mg-Al-Hydrotalcite
The preparation and microwave modification of Mg-Al-hydrotalcite were studied.The effect of modification temperature,modification time,titanate dosage etc factors on the activation index were investigated through orthogonal experiment.The optimum conditions for modification include titanate dosage of 5 %,modification temperature of 75 ℃,modification time of 30 min.The performance test were carried out which pre and post modification of Mg-Al-hydrotalcite added to PVC.Experimental result showed that Mg-Al-hydrotalcite could improve the thermal stability and processing property of PVC,modified Mg-Al-hydrotalcite had a better performance with obvious fire retardation and smoke suppression effects.
